    Re: Pads for adams swirl killer

    Quote Originally Posted by boxerdude84 View Post
    Other question is it has a 5 inch backing plate, can I use a 5 inch pad?? I was told not to..I really like the rupes pads but they don`t have a 5.5 inch pad


    Sent from my iPhone using Tapatalk
    The 6" Rupes pads are 5" at the backing plate interface.

    Lake Country HDO pads are nice as well. The cutting pad and polishing pad are nice.
